Hi Dana..Sorry this went so long with no response...
 The thing that helped me in those weeks was keeping busy and loads of water... I chewed a lot of sugar free gum, and I ate 6 times a day just really small meals... in bandster hell I went by a calorie allowtment.. I set a calorie goal and divided that into 4 or 6 meals and planned my day that way...
  I hope that helps!! Keep it up ok? its hard but It will get better

I also carry a luunchbox everywhere.. I swear by it... I carry a yogurt,  bottle water and protein bar with me everywhere. I have one that looks just like a purse but its a LUNCHBOX!!  The girls can testify to that.. I also carry peanuts, things like that...
